CM Fadnavis interacts with saints and mahants at his Varsha residence
13-Jun-2025 05:47 PM 2552
Mumbai, June 13 ( UNI) Chief Minister Devendra Fadnavis met saints and mahants and discussed with them the 350th Shaheed Samagam of Shri Guru Tegh Bahadur Sahib Ji and the 350th Guru Ta Gaddi Samagam programme of Guru Gobind Singh ji at three places in the state. The Samagam is planned in Nanded, Nagpur and Navi Mumbai. The Chief Minister said that Guru Tegh Bahadur ji dedicated himself to the society when it was being exploited during the period of conflict. He fought to eliminate the injustices being done during the tyrannical rule of Aurangzeb. "It is important for the next generation to remember this part of history that he was martyred for the greater good of society," he said. Fadnavis promised that his government would provide full cooperation to this programme and said that the history of Shri Guru Tegh Bahadur Saheb ji and Guru Gobind Singh ji will definitely be conveyed to the next generations through these programmes. The CM said various communities will come together to organize the programme. "This gives us an opportunity to build our country through unity and convey our history to the new generation through such gatherings," he said...////...
